About Us
Here at T‑SQUARED we don’t just design buildings – we Make Space for Genius. We design, build, validate and maintain highly specialised facilities for scientists and innovators who change the world. Employee‑owned and independent, we offer an end‑to‑end solution for the complex, dedicated facilities that high‑tech regulated industries need. We make and maintain spaces where our clients do amazing things, from preventing the next global pandemic to cutting‑edge research at the speed of light. Their work changes the world, and we make it possible.
